Job Description

Job Summary
Responsible for organizing and managing Medicare seminars including educational/sales events workshops and community outreach initiatives. Ensures all events run smoothly meet regulatory requirements and help promote Medicare education and awareness within the community. The role requires strong project management skills the ability to engage with the senior population and a deep understanding of Medicare programs and El Paso Health Medicare Advantage. Position is primarily officebased with frequent travel for event coordination. Must be available to work evenings and weekends for community events.

Work Experience
Three years of experience with event planning and/or coordination are required preferably in healthcare or Medicare related services. Strong healthcare customer service background working with Medicare Medicaid and/or senior services is preferred.

License/Registration/Certification
Current and active General Lines Agent; Life Accident Health and HMO license issued through the Texas Department of Insurance is required.
Valid and current State drivers license is required.
Completion of EPH Medicare Plan Benefitcertification is required within 90 days of being in the position.

Education and Training
High school diploma or equivalent is required.
